A Fabergé silver-mounted cut-glass decanter, Moscow, 1908-1917
the tapering glass body cut in a heavy diamond pattern, the plain polished neck chased with a border of flowers and
foliage, with suspending bow-mounted laurel festoons, struck K. Fabergé in Cyrillic beneath the Imperial warrant, 84
standard, scratched inventory number 29052
height 18.5, 7¼in.
Excellent condition; with only minor surface wear and scratches consistent with age.
